Besides typical Buffalo wings, the city of Buffalo is likewise recognized for one more classic: beef on weck.
The sandwich is usually served with horseradish sauce and au jus for dipping. While the sandwich's origins are up for debate, it is commonly connected to a German immigrant population in Buffalo during the 19th century (Buffalo hour). Buffalo Lighthouse (or Buffalo Key Light) is a historic lighthouse situated near the mouth of the Buffalo River, where it meets Lake Erie.

The Buffalo Heritage Slide Carousel is a vintage tourist attraction located along the shores of the Buffalo River near the Canalside. This perfectly recovered slide carousel attributes three rows of hand-carved and hand-painted animals standing for legendary Buffalo spots and historic figures.

For some, a see to a brand-new place like Buffalo is never full without some shopping therapy. Go into Vidler's 5 & 10, a family-owned five-and-dime shop that has actually been a cherished destination because its facility in 1930. It is also widely identified as one of the biggest five-and-dime stores in the United States, with two floorings of antique beauty filled with over 75,000 items varying from sentimental playthings and timeless candies to kitchen area devices and distinct novelties.
